Our Celosia seeds are annual plants with very colourful summer flowering in spikes or cockscomb crests that bring bright touches of colour to the garden, terrace, or bouquets. The Feathery Spike Celosia (Celosia argentea var. plumosa) is prized for its feathery floral spikes. Among the most popular varieties is 'Flamingo Feather'', which offers incredibly elegant long pink floral spikes with a silver base. The Crested Celosia, also known as "cockscomb" (Celosia argentea var. cristata), is distinguished by its inflorescences in the form of wavy, fleshy crests, as seen in 'Triangle Mix', with vibrant and bold colours. The 'Fresh look Red & Yellow ' variety, with its stout yellow and red spike flowers, is eye-catching in borders and containers. Also worth mentioning is Celosia 'China Town' remarkable for its purple foliage and very bright red flowers, highly decorative throughout the season.
Celosias thrive in full sun and well-drained soils. They bloom generously throughout the summer and are easy to grow. Regular watering without excess is recommended, as Celosia tolerates heat well but dislikes waterlogged soils. Sow them indoors in March and transplant outdoors after the last frost.
